Professional Installation Guidelines
Pre-Installation Planning Phase
Always conduct thorough load calculations and thermal analysis before installation. Verify compatibility with existing electrical infrastructure and ensure proper clearance margins.
Mounting Best Practices
Utilize manufacturer-recommended support brackets and maintain specified bending radii. Implement torque-controlled fastening to achieve optimal electrical contact without damaging components.
Frequently Asked Questions
What maintenance do GRL busbars require?
Periodic thermal imaging inspections and connection integrity checks ensure long-term reliability. Most systems operate maintenance-free for extended periods under normal conditions.
Can existing facilities retrofit GRL busbars?
Yes, modular designs facilitate straightforward retrofitting. Professional assessment determines compatibility and required modifications.
